Некоторые преимущества использования Effector по сравнению с другими стейт-менеджерами:
Удобство в разработке. 3 Логичный API и отзывчивое сообщество разработчиков поддерживают проект. 3
Разделение работы с данными. 1 Можно легко разделять работу с данными по разным хранилищам и не держать всё в одном. 1
Меньше кода и меньший размер. 1 Нет надобности создавать отдельные классы-модели и прописывать им интерфейсы. 1
Минимальное взаимодействие компонента и хранилища. 1 При грамотно созданных моделях в компоненте не нужно отслеживать обновление хранилища. 1 Достаточно подключить его в компонент — он всегда актуален и перерисовывается при каждом обновлении хранилища. 1
Производительность. 13 Используется неизменяемый стейт, нет необходимости писать много дублирующегося кода, что повышает производительность проекта. 1
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.